Output 8fa9851563691fbc045c95b6556c401f340a14a932189275bc34deef9974275b:55

value
2500560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c63c83bf208cea67e3f855285f727c3e3f5a416 OP_EQUAL
address
3LKjJfSHcD89ap3opDCBhoZUqzqj7h8dhR
transaction
8fa9851563691fbc045c95b6556c401f340a14a932189275bc34deef9974275b